rep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
* ipa-inline.c (max_count_real, max_relbenefit_real,
2014-12-27
hubicka
*
ipa-inlin
e
.
c (max_count_
r
eal
,
max_relbenefit_real,
commit
|
commitdiff
|
tree
2014-12-27
hub
i
cka
* sreal
.
h (
s
rea
l
::shift): Fix sani
t
y
c
h
e
ck
.
commit
|
commitdiff
|
tree
2014-12-19
h
u
bicka
* hash-
t
able
.
h (struct pointer
_
hash): Fix for
m
ating
.
commit
|
commitdiff
|
tree
2014-12-17
hub
i
cka
* sreal
.
h (sreal::no
r
m
a
li
z
e): Implement inline
.
commit
|
commitdiff
|
tree
2014-12-16
hubicka
* fibonacci_heap
.
h (min): Return m_data inste
a
d of
.
.
.
commit
|
commitdiff
|
tree
2014-12-16
h
u
bicka
* ipa-inli
n
e-an
a
lysis
.
c
(
will_b
e
_nonconsta
n
t_predicate
.
.
.
commit
|
commitdiff
|
tree
2014-12-16
hubick
a
* hwint
.
c (a
b
s_hwi, abs
u
_hwi): Move to
.
.
.
commit
|
commitdiff
|
tree
2014-12-15
hubicka
* decl2
.
c
(decl_needed_p): When not optimiz
i
ng, do
.
.
.
commit
|
commitdiff
|
tree
2014-12-15
hub
i
cka
PR lto/
6
4043
commit
|
commitdiff
|
tree
2014-12-15
h
u
bicka
* sreal
.
h (to
_
d
o
ub
l
e): N
e
w method
.
commit
|
commitdiff
|
tree
2014-12-15
hub
i
cka
PR ipa/61602
commit
|
commitdiff
|
tree
2014-12-15
hubicka
*
i
p
a
.
c (proc
e
ss_r
e
ferences
)
: Fix conditoinal o
n
flag_op
t
imi
z
e
commit
|
commitdiff
|
tree
2014-12-15
hubi
c
ka
PR ipa/61
5
58
commit
|
commitdiff
|
tree
2014-12-15
hubicka
* cgraphunit
.
c (a
n
a
ly
z
e_functions): Always analyze
.
.
.
commit
|
commitdiff
|
tree
2014-12-15
hubicka
PR l
t
o/64
0
43
commit
|
commitdiff
|
tree
2014-12-15
hubic
k
a
* cgraphunit
.
c
(a
n
a
lyze_f
u
nctions
)
: Do not analyze
.
.
.
commit
|
commitdiff
|
tree
2014-12-12
hubicka
*
ip
a
-
inline
.
c (ipa_in
l
i
n
e): Fix con
d
i
t
io
n
on whe
n
commit
|
commitdiff
|
tree
2014-12-12
hu
b
icka
*
ipa-devirt
.
c
(
poss
i
bl
e
_p
o
l
y
m
or
p
hic_
c
a
l
l_target
s
.
.
.
commit
|
commitdiff
|
tree
2014-12-11
hubicka
P
R
ipa/
6
1324
commit
|
commitdiff
|
tree
2014-12-10
hubicka
* doc/
i
nvoke
.
texi:
(
-
d
evirtualize-
a
t-ltra
n
s): Document
.
commit
|
commitdiff
|
tree
2014-12-07
hubicka
* s
y
mtab
.
c (sym
t
ab_node::equ
a
l_a
d
dress_to): New func
t
ion
.
commit
|
commitdiff
|
tree
2014-11-24
hu
b
icka
PR ipa/6
3
67
1
commit
|
commitdiff
|
tree
2014-11-22
hubicka
* ip
a
.
c (symbol
_
t
abl
e
::remov
e
_
u
nreachable_nodes):
.
.
.
commit
|
commitdiff
|
tree
2014-11-20
hubic
k
a
*
t
r
e
e
.
c (free_
l
ang_d
a
ta_in_type): If BINFO h
a
s no
.
.
.
commit
|
commitdiff
|
tree
2014-11-19
hubicka
PR bootstrap/63963
commit
|
commitdiff
|
tree
2014-11-18
hubicka
* ipa-cp
.
c (ipcp_cloning_candidate_p
)
: Use opt_for_fn
.
commit
|
commitdiff
|
tree
2014-11-17
hubicka
*
i
p
a-c
p
.
c (ipa
_
get_ind
i
rect
_
edge_tar
g
et_1): Handle
.
.
.
commit
|
commitdiff
|
tree
2014-11-17
hubicka
* tree
.
c
(
f
r
ee_lang_data_in_decl): Set DECL_FUNC
T
I
O
N_SPECIF
.
.
.
commit
|
commitdiff
|
tree
2014-11-17
hubicka
* cgra
p
hun
i
t
.
c (analyze_functions
)
: Use o
p
t
_for_
f
n
.
commit
|
commitdiff
|
tree
2014-11-17
hubicka
* cgraph
.
c (symbo
l
_table::cre
a
te_edg
e
): Use
o
pt_fo
r
_fn
.
commit
|
commitdiff
|
tree
2014-11-17
hubicka
*
p
re
d
ic
t
.
c (ma
y
be_ho
t
_frequenc
y
_p):
Use opt_for_fn
.
commit
|
commitdiff
|
tree
2014-11-17
hubi
c
ka
* tree
.
c (fr
e
e
_
lang_data_in_decl): Annotate
a
l
l
f
unctio
.
.
.
commit
|
commitdiff
|
tree
2014-11-16
h
ubic
k
a
* i
p
a-po
l
ymorphic-call
.
c
commit
|
commitdiff
|
tree
2014-11-16
hubicka
* passes
.
c (
e
x
ecute_one_pass):
D
o not
apply all transf
o
rm
s
.
.
.
commit
|
commitdiff
|
tree
2014-11-15
h
u
bi
c
ka
*
lto-st
r
e
a
m
er-out
.
c (h
a
sh_tree): Use cl_optimizat
i
on_has
h
.
commit
|
commitdiff
|
tree
2014-11-14
hubicka
* ipa-prop
.
h (ip
a
_known_type
_
data):
Remove
.
commit
|
commitdiff
|
tree
2014-11-14
hubicka
* optc-sa
v
e-gen
.
awk: Output cl
_
targe
t
_opt
i
on_eq,
commit
|
commitdiff
|
tree
2014-11-14
hu
b
icka
* optc-s
a
ve-gen
.
awk: Output cl_t
a
rget_option_eq,
commit
|
commitdiff
|
tree
2014-11-10
hu
b
icka
PR
b
ootstrap/63573
commit
|
commitdiff
|
tree
2014-10-15
hubicka
P
R
l
t
o/62026
commit
|
commitdiff
|
tree
2014-10-15
h
u
bic
k
a
* loop-unr
o
ll
.
c: (
d
ecide_unrolling_and
_
p
eeling): Rename to
commit
|
commitdiff
|
tree
2014-10-13
hu
b
i
ck
a
PR tree-optimizatio
n
/62127
commit
|
commitdiff
|
tree
2014-10-13
hubicka
PR bootstrap/63496
commit
|
commitdiff
|
tree
2014-10-08
hubicka
* ipa-po
l
ym
o
rphic-call
.
c (
e
xtr_type_from_vtbl_store
.
.
.
commit
|
commitdiff
|
tree
2014-10-05
hu
b
icka
* ipa-prop
.
c
(
try_
m
ake_ed
g
e_direc
t
_
v
irtual_call):
.
.
.
commit
|
commitdiff
|
tree
2014-10-05
h
ubicka
* ipa-polymorphic-call
.
c (possible_pla
c
ement_new)
.
.
.
commit
|
commitdiff
|
tree
2014-10-05
hubicka
* ipa-polymorp
h
i
c
-
c
all
.
c (wal
k
_
s
s
a
_copie
s
): Recognize
commit
|
commitdiff
|
tree
2014-10-05
h
ubicka
PR ipa/61144
commit
|
commitdiff
|
tree
2014-10-04
hubicka
*
g
++
.
dg/ipa/dev
i
rt-46
.
C:
New testcase
.
commit
|
commitdiff
|
tree
2014-10-04
hub
i
cka
* testsui
t
e/g++
.
dg
/
ipa/devirt-
4
2
.
C: Ne
w
t
e
stc
a
se
.
commit
|
commitdiff
|
tree
2014-10-03
hu
b
icka
*
i
p
a-polymorphic-call
.
c (
d
e
c
l_maybe_in_cons
t
ructio
n
_p
.
.
.
commit
|
commitdiff
|
tree
2014-10-03
hubicka
*
i
p
a-polymorp
h
ic-call
.
c (decl_mayb
e
_in_co
n
s
t
ruction_
p
.
.
.
commit
|
commitdiff
|
tree
2014-10-03
hu
b
i
c
ka
* cgraph
.
h (str
u
ct indir
e
ct_cal
l
_info): Add IN_P
O
LYMORPHIC_
.
.
.
commit
|
commitdiff
|
tree
2014-10-03
hu
b
i
c
k
a
* cgraph
.
h (ipa_p
o
lymorphic_cal
l
_
c
ontext):
commit
|
commitdiff
|
tree
2014-10-02
h
ubicka
* cgraphclones
.
c (buil
d
_functi
o
n_type_skip_args
)
:
.
.
.
commit
|
commitdiff
|
tree
2014-10-02
hubicka
* ip
a
-pr
o
p
.
h
(i
p
a_
g
et_controlled_uses)
:
Add hack to
.
.
.
commit
|
commitdiff
|
tree
2014-10-02
hubicka
* ipa
.
c (
w
alk_polymorphic_call
_
targets
)
:
Av
o
i
d
ICE
.
.
.
commit
|
commitdiff
|
tree
2014-10-02
hubicka
* ipa-prop
.
c
(ipa_
m
odif
y
_formal_parameters
)
: Do not
.
.
.
commit
|
commitdiff
|
tree
2014-10-02
hubicka
* ipa-polymorphic-call
.
c
commit
|
commitdiff
|
tree
2014-09-27
hubicka
PR
ipa/60665
commit
|
commitdiff
|
tree
2014-09-27
hubicka
P
R
ipa/6212
1
commit
|
commitdiff
|
tree
2014-09-27
hubick
a
P
R
middle-end/35545
commit
|
commitdiff
|
tree
2014-09-26
hubicka
* ipa-prop
.
c (ipa_intraprocedural
_
devirtualization
.
.
.
commit
|
commitdiff
|
tree
2014-09-25
h
u
bicka
* ipa-utils
.
h
(
s
u
bbinfo_with_vtable_at_offse
t
, type_all_
d
er
.
.
.
commit
|
commitdiff
|
tree
2014-09-25
hubi
c
ka
* ipa-devirt
.
c (
p
olymor
p
h
i
c_cal
l
_
target_d): Add SPEC
U
LATIVE
.
.
.
commit
|
commitdiff
|
tree
2014-09-25
hub
i
cka
* ipa-devi
r
t
.
c (p
o
ssible_polymorph
i
c_call_targets
.
.
.
commit
|
commitdiff
|
tree
2014-09-25
hubic
k
a
Fix pr
e
viou
s
co
m
m
it
.
commit
|
commitdiff
|
tree
2014-09-25
hubicka
* cgraph
.
h
(class ipa_po
l
ymor
p
h
i
c_call_
c
ontext): Mov
e
.
.
.
commit
|
commitdiff
|
tree
2014-09-24
hu
b
icka
* ipa-util
s
.
h (pol
y
morphic_
c
all_context): Add
commit
|
commitdiff
|
tree
2014-09-23
hubicka
*
tree
.
h (int_bit_position): Turn int
o
i
nline functio
n
;
commit
|
commitdiff
|
tree
2014-09-22
hubicka
* char
s
et
.
c
(
c
o
n
v
ersion): Rename to
.
.
.
commit
|
commitdiff
|
tree
2014-09-22
hubicka
* tree
-
s
sa-ccp
.
c
(prop_val
u
e_d): Rename to
.
.
.
commit
|
commitdiff
|
tree
2014-09-22
hubi
c
ka
* tree-ssa
-
ccp
.
c (prop
_
value_d):
R
e
nam
e
to
.
.
.
commit
|
commitdiff
|
tree
2014-09-20
hub
i
cka
* ip
a
-utils
.
h (ip
a
_pol
y
m
o
rphic_call_context):
T
urn
.
.
.
commit
|
commitdiff
|
tree
2014-09-20
h
u
bick
a
*
i
pa-visibil
i
ty
.
c (varpool_node::ext
e
rnal
l
y_visible_p
.
.
.
commit
|
commitdiff
|
tree
2014-09-20
hubicka
* diagnostic
.
c (warning
_
n): Ne
w
function
.
commit
|
commitdiff
|
tree
2014-09-20
hub
i
cka
PR tree-
o
ptimization/6325
5
commit
|
commitdiff
|
tree
2014-09-19
h
u
bi
c
ka
PR c
+
+/61825
commit
|
commitdiff
|
tree
2014-09-19
hub
i
c
ka
P
R
lt
o
/
6
3286
commit
|
commitdiff
|
tree
2014-09-19
hubicka
PR lto/6329
8
commit
|
commitdiff
|
tree
2014-09-17
hubicka
* ipa-de
v
irt
.
c (type_pair,
d
efaul
t
_h
a
shset_traits
.
.
.
commit
|
commitdiff
|
tree
2014-09-13
hubicka
* tree
.
c
(need_
a
ssembler_n
a
me_p):
S
tore C++ t
y
pe mang
l
ing
.
.
.
commit
|
commitdiff
|
tree
2014-09-11
hubicka
* common
.
opt (flto-od
r
-
t
ype-mer
g
ing): N
e
w flag
.
commit
|
commitdiff
|
tree
2014-09-11
hubicka
* varpo
o
l
.
c
(varpo
o
l_node::ctor_us
e
able_for_fol
d
ing_p
.
.
.
commit
|
commitdiff
|
tree
2014-09-11
hub
i
cka
PR
tr
e
e-o
p
tim
i
zation/6
3
186
commit
|
commitdiff
|
tree
2014-09-10
hubicka
PR ipa/63166
commit
|
commitdiff
|
tree
2014-08-21
h
u
bicka
PR tree
-
o
p
timization/62091
commit
|
commitdiff
|
tree
2014-08-21
hu
b
i
cka
*
tree-profile
.
c
(tree_profiling): Skip e
x
t
e
rna
l
function
s
commit
|
commitdiff
|
tree
2014-08-20
hub
i
cka
* g++
.
d
g
/ip
a
/dev
i
rt-37
.
C: Fix
t
est
c
ase
.
commit
|
commitdiff
|
tree
2014-08-20
hubicka
*
coverag
e
.
c (coverage_com
p
u
t
e_pro
f
il
e
_id): Ret
u
rn
.
.
.
commit
|
commitdiff
|
tree
2014-08-20
h
u
bicka
* cgraphun
i
t
.
c (ipa_passes, c
o
mpile): Res
h
edu
l
e
commit
|
commitdiff
|
tree
2014-08-19
hub
i
cka
* ipa-visibility
.
c (update_visib
i
lity_by_resolu
t
i
on_info
.
.
.
commit
|
commitdiff
|
tree
2014-08-18
h
ubicka
* ipa-visi
b
i
l
ity
.
c (
u
pdat
e
_visib
i
lity
_
b
y
_
re
s
olution_info
.
.
.
commit
|
commitdiff
|
tree
2014-08-18
hubicka
* gimple-fold
.
c (fold_g
i
mple
_
assig
n
): Do not into
r
u
d
ce
.
.
.
commit
|
commitdiff
|
tree
2014-08-16
h
u
b
i
c
ka
*
i
p
a
-
u
t
il
s
.
h (ipa_polymorphic_call_
c
ontext
)
: T
u
rn
.
.
.
commit
|
commitdiff
|
tree
2014-08-14
hub
i
cka
PR tree-
o
ptimiz
a
tion/62091
commit
|
commitdiff
|
tree
2014-08-14
h
u
b
icka
*
ipa-utils
.
h (compa
r
e_
v
irtual_tables): Declare
.
commit
|
commitdiff
|
tree
2014-08-09
hu
b
icka
*
g+
+
.
dg/ipa/devirt-35
.
C:
Fix
template
.
commit
|
commitdiff
|
tree
2014-08-07
hu
b
icka
*
ipa-devirt
.
c: Include g
i
mple-pret
t
y-prin
t
.
h
commit
|
commitdiff
|
tree
2014-08-03
h
u
bicka
* ipa-
d
evirt
.
c (
o
dr_
t
y
p
e_warn
_
count
)
:
Add typ
e
.
commit
|
commitdiff
|
tree
next